Pharmacovigilance Specialist
Manage Risk Evaluation and Mitigation Strategy (REMS)
What You Do Today
Monitor REMS compliance metrics, audit prescriber/pharmacy certifications, assess if REMS goals are being met, report to FDA
AI That Applies
AI dashboards track REMS metrics in real time, predict compliance gaps, and auto-generate FDA assessment reports

What Changes
REMS monitoring is continuous and predictive instead of retrospective quarterly audits
What Stays
You interpret whether the REMS is achieving its goals, recommend modifications, and manage FDA interactions
